Benni going all guns blazing against SuperSport in Nedbank Cup

Cape Town - Cape Town City coach Benni McCarthy says he will choose his strongest available squad for Saturday's Nedbank Cup Round of 32 clash against SuperSport United.

City have made a late charge in the Premiership title race having collected an impressive 21 points from their last 10 matches in South Africa's top flight.

The Citizens are absolutely flying having hammered Free State Stars 5-0 in last Wednesday's league encounter at Cape Town Stadium.

McCarthy's charges are seven points behind leaders Bidvest Wits in fourth place and they have a game-in-hand.

However, Bafana Bafana's all-time leading goal-scorer insists his team will be at full strength against United.

He said: "For us there is no cup games or league games, every game is a must-win.

"We don't toy with the opposition by playing youngsters, we take every competition seriously. We are going out there to win it."

Yet, the 41-year-old did admit he may some headaches in defence with central defender Taariq Fielies suspended, while Edmilson Dove and Kouassi Kouadja are doubtful with injury. It means 21-year-old Keanu Cupido could play alongside Kwanda Mngonyama.

McCarthy concluded: "We have got the young boy Keanu, he was equally as good as Fielies, Kwanda [Mngonyama] and Dove when he was given the opportunity to play."

Saturday's action in the Mother City gets underway from 20:15 at the Cape Town Stadium.
